NESARC -- National Endangered Species Act Reform Coalition

Description

The National Endangered Species Act Reform Coalition is the country’s oldest broad-based, national coalition dedicated solely to achieving improvements to the Endangered Species Act. The Coalition includes rural irrigators, municipalities, farmers, electric utilities, and many other individuals, organizations, and businesses that are supportive of updating the Act to achieve the ultimate goal of species recovery. Since its inception in 1991, NESARC consistently has proven that it is possible to carve out a balanced middle-ground on the issue of ESA improvement. The diverse membership of the Coalition, its single issue focus, and its emphasis on grassroots activities have attracted a growing number of major, and geographically diverse groups to support our efforts.

Our strong advocacy program has been instrumental in pushing regulators to improve how it implements the Act. And we have supported and worked with numerous Members of Congress – of both parties – as they have developed their proposals to improve the Act.

We seek an open debate so that the ESA will work better both for the species it was designed to protect and the communities that have to live and work with the law.
